Transaction d72150eac230019b9353d7721ca863996844f9c14c45a6503594e61a522eaae0
1 Input
1 Output
-
d72150eac230019b9353d7721ca863996844f9c14c45a6503594e61a522eaae0:0
- value
- 659814
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88cbfbeddd8b003509db0856d37ed96d1fddba57 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DUKG9rCdLm4AH5QPV5Nb18ANpNgd1aRjw